Keycaps
The plastic shell that protects the keyboard's switch mechanisms is known as a keycap. They can be made and printed with different designs, colors, and symbols to change the appearance and feel of a keyboard. They can be cylindrical (curving to the sides like the fat cylinder were resting on it) or flat. The majority of modern keyboards have a cylindrical shape, whereas laptops typically have flat keycaps. ABS and PBT are the two primary types of keyboard keycaps. Each keycap has its own unique set of properties, which provide it with a distinct sound appearance, feel, and look.
Keycaps, in general, are prone to being damaged because of wear and tear. Over time, they may also become hard and brittle. Lubricants
The use of lubricants to reduce friction between moving parts of mechanical devices lets them perform more efficiently and smoothly. Lubricants guard against wear and corrosion. Lubricants come in a variety of forms, from liquids to solids. They are often used together with other chemicals to enhance their efficacy.
Lubricants are used in all kinds of equipment and vehicles to reduce friction, however they are especially useful for locks on automobiles and vehicles due to the constant need to open and close them. A lubricant that is effective will last a long time and be easy to clean. It is also resistant to dirt and sludge which can clog the mechanisms.
Many lubricants consist of petroleum fractions mixed with additives like solvents, thickeners, anti-corrosion agents, and metal deactivators. The additives give the lubricant special properties, such as viscosity enhancement as well as antioxidation, shear stability and resistance to corrosion.
Liquid lubricants can be found in a variety of types, from a basic bottle of penetrating oil to advanced formulations that are designed for heavy industrial use. Penetrating liquids lubricants penetrate tiny cracks and crevices, providing immediate lubrication. One of the most frequently utilized is WD-40 but it's not designed for long-term use as a lubricant.
Another popular type of lubricant is powdered graphite. This can be squeezed into lock mechanisms to make them easier to open and close. Its main benefit is that it does not attract dust, which means it lasts longer than other lubricants like oils. It is not suitable to make a keyway that is coated or painted as the graphite could alter the color of the surface.
A dry Teflon-based lubricant is available in aerosol form, making it simpler to spray directly into the interior of a locked mechanism. It forms a thin layer on the interior of the lock that repels water, dust and chemicals. Some locksmiths prefer this type of lubricant, which is much longer-lasting than other alternatives such as graphite and WD-40.
